Solution Overview

Problem

Enterprise computing environments with non-standardized configurations become unmanageable, leading to increased complexity, security vulnerabilities, and costly migrations due to the vast variety of applications and configurations that need to be recreated during infrastructure changes.

Innovation Solution

A system utilizing big data processing and artificial intelligence to scan and analyze middleware configurations across multiple platforms, identifying standard configurations and using these standards to automate reconfiguration and migration to a new environment, ensuring compliance and security.

AI summary

Systems and techniques for automated standards-based computing system reconfiguration are described herein. An existing configuration may be obtained of a first computing system operating in a first computing environment. A second computing system in a second computing environment may be identified that provides a function of the first computing system using the existing configuration. A second computing system existing configuration of the second computing system may be evaluated to identify a set of configuration deviations. A notification may be transmitted to a computing device of an administrator of the second computing system. The notification may include an indication of the set of configuration deviations.
